iPad 3 Wi-Fi only IOS 5.1.1 JB freezes whenever I attempt to follow a link from within a reading/news app such as Pulse, Flipboard, Zite, or Trap!t. No error message, just a frozen screen. Can force close app, but closing/restarting app doesn't solve problem. Neither does deleting/reinstalling apps, or rebooting iPad. Can't RE-restore/rejailbreak, because I'm on factory 5.1.1. Any troubleshooting suggestions would be appreciated.

Do you have any tweaks installed that interact with Safari? One of them might be interfering with the "open link" function.

If you don't know, or don't have any, could you list your tweaks? Something you've got installed is interfering - maybe we can see what it might be from your list.

Thanks for your reply, Mickey330. I may have isolated the problem and solved it. One of the misbehaving apps was Facebook. I deleted all the misbehaving apps, including Facebook this time, and reinstalled and tested them one by one, finally reinstalling Facebook, and they are all playing nicely now. I will treat this issue as solved for now, unless It reappears, in which case I'll itemize my tweaks in a new post. Thanks again.
